Berlin pursues Majidi’s “Song of Sparrows”
Tehran Times Art Desk

TEHRAN -- Berlin International Film Festival’s chief director Dieter Kosslick has invited Majid Majidi’s “Song of Sparrows” to compete in the gala.

In a letter addressed to Majidi, Kosslick expressed his appreciation over the submission of Majidi’s latest movie to the secretariat of the event, and said that the selection board had been very impressed with the movie.

The letter contained a formal invitation from the organizers for the movie to compete in the festival and asked Majidi to inform them about his decision.

“We would be happy to receive you and the crew on the red carpet of the Berlin Film Festival (February 7 to 17) this year,” reads part of the letter.

Majidi’s project manager, Javad Noruzbeigi told ISNA that Majidi wants to screen the movie at the Fajr Film Festival first, before it finds its way to foreign festivals.

“Fortunately the 26th Fajr festival runs from February 1 to 10, which is before the Berlin schedule, and we will do our best to make sure that ‘Song of Sparrows’ enters both galas,” Noruzbeigi added.

“Song of Sparrows” features the story of Karim who is a worker at an ostrich farm in the suburbs of the town of Shahriyar. He is quite content with his life and his small house, but he is dismissed from his job due to a series of events. He is forced to leave his hometown and move to the city for work, but several incidents occur which greatly affect his life.

The screenplay is written by Majidi and Mehran Kashani.

Cinematographer Turaj Mansuri, sound recorder Yadollah Najafi, make-up artist Saeid Malekan, stage and costume designer Asghar Nejad-Imani and photographer Ali Tabrizi are amongst the film’s crew.

Majid’s other credits include “The Father”, “The Children of Heaven”, “The Color of Paradise”, “Baran” and “The Weeping Willow”.
